jQuery 是一个快速、小巧且功能丰富的 JavaScript 库,它简化了 HTML 文档遍历、事件处理、动画和 Ajax 交互。jQuery 标签特效通常指的是使用 jQuery 来实现的各种动态效果,比如元素的淡入淡出、滑动、缩放等。
jQuery 标签特效基于 CSS 和 JavaScript,通过 jQuery 提供的丰富方法来操作 DOM 元素,实现页面元素的动态变化。
.fadeIn()
, .fadeOut()
, .fadeToggle()
等。.slideUp()
, .slideDown()
, .slideToggle()
等。transform
属性结合 jQuery 实现。.animate()
方法,可以自定义复杂的动画效果。以下是一个简单的 jQuery 淡入淡出效果的示例: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>jQuery Fade Example</title>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<style>
.fade-element {
display: none;
padding: 20px;
background-color: #f0f0f0;
}
</style>
</head>
<body>
<button id="fadeButton">Toggle Fade</button>
<div class="fade-element">This is a fade element.</div>
<script>
$(document).ready(function(){
$("#fadeButton").click(function(){
$(".fade-element").fadeToggle("slow");
});
});
</script>
</body>
</html>
问题:jQuery 标签特效在某些浏览器上不生效。 原因:可能是由于浏览器版本过旧,或者 jQuery 库没有正确加载。 解决方法:
问题:动画效果卡顿。 原因:可能是由于页面元素过多,或者动画效果过于复杂。 解决方法:
通过以上方法,可以有效地解决 jQuery 标签特效中常见的问题。
领取专属 10元无门槛券
手把手带您无忧上云